The Challenge

Compliance efforts fail when governance is either too vague (“be responsible”) or too heavy (paperwork and approvals teams route around).

Common gaps include incomplete inventories, inconsistent documentation, unclear decision rights, ad-hoc vendor risk, and controls that are not testable or evidenced in production.

Our Approach

We implement a pragmatic AIMS: clear decision rights, a control library mapped to your risk profile, and evidence capture integrated into delivery workflows.

The goal is simple: faster approvals with better evidence - without slowing teams down.
